JRR Tolkien left letters from Santa to his kids on Christmas. They have since been made into a book, Letters from Father Christmas. It was a continuous story about the goings on at the North Pole. There were 20-some years of letters. I wish I had know that when my son was little. I think it would have been fun to do something similar.
I always found more magic as a parent watching my son get so excited for Santa and Christmas than I ever remember as a kid.
